Observe these precautions: G When checking the fluid level, make sure the top of the master cylinder reservoirs are level. G Use only the designated quality brake fluid, otherwise the rubber seals may deteriorate, causing leakage and poor brake performance. Recommended brake fluid: DOT 4 G G G Brake fluid may deteriorate painted surfaces or plastic parts. Always clean up spilled fluid immediately. Have a Yamaha dealer check the cause if the brake fluid level goes down. G Refill with the same type of brake fluid. Mixing fluids may result in a harmful chemical reaction and lead to poor brake performance. Be careful that water does not enter the master cylinder reservoirs when refilling. Water will significantly lower the boiling point of the fluid and may result in vapor lock. 8-45
